IBC company incorporation Seychelles
    Back

IBC company incorporation Seychelles – Complete Guide


IBC company incorporation Seychelles offers a fast, confidential, and tax-efficient corporate structure for international business endeavors that global entrepreneurs highly value.

Dreaming of a business structure that’s as flexible and ambitious as you are? For many global entrepreneurs, that dream leads them to the Seychelles. An efficient and streamlined process for IBC company incorporation Seychelles makes this jurisdiction a premier choice for international trade, investment, and asset protection. At We Form Online, we specialize in transforming this complex process into a simple, seamless experience, allowing you to focus on what truly matters: growing your business.

Thinking about forming your company in Seychelles? We Form Online makes it simple — our team handles everything from name registration to compliance setup.

Choose Your Jurisdiction

3D icons illustrating Seychelles IBC benefits: confidentiality shield, tax efficiency coins, compliance documents around Seychelles globe
Key advantages of Seychelles IBC incorporation visualized

Key Benefits of Incorporating an IBC in Seychelles

Opting for a Seychelles IBC isn’t just about having an offshore company; it’s about leveraging a powerful set of strategic advantages that can accelerate your global ambitions.

  • Complete Exemption from Local Taxes: Seychelles IBCs benefit from a territorial tax system. This means that as long as the company’s income is generated outside of the Seychelles, it is legally exempt from all local income taxes, capital gains taxes, and stamp duty.
  • Robust Confidentiality and Asset Protection: The identities of the company’s beneficial owners, directors, and shareholders are not filed on any public register, ensuring a high degree of privacy. This confidentiality is a critical tool for legitimate asset protection and managing personal financial information securely.
  • Speedy and Simple Incorporation: The Seychelles registry is known for its efficiency. With all documents in order, an IBC can be officially incorporated in as little as 24-48 hours. Our team at We Form Online has refined this process, often completing preliminary name checks and document preparation on the same day a request is made.
  • Minimalist Corporate Requirements: The administrative burden is refreshingly light. There is no requirement for a minimum paid-up capital, annual audits are not mandatory for most IBCs, and there is no need to appoint local directors or shareholders.
  • Total Location Independence: The entire structure can be managed from anywhere in the world. Directors and shareholders are not required to reside in the Seychelles, and corporate meetings can be held globally, offering true operational freedom.

Navigating the requirements for IBC registration in Seychelles can feel complex, but it doesn’t have to be. Our team at We Form Online has streamlined the process to handle every detail for you, ensuring a fast, compliant, and hassle-free incorporation.

What Exactly Is a Seychelles IBC?

A Seychelles International Business Company (IBC) is a legal entity specifically designed for entrepreneurs and corporations operating on a global scale. Governed by the International Business Companies Act, it offers a robust framework for activities like international trade, holding investments, providing consultancy services, or owning intellectual property.

The structure is renowned for its flexibility—it can be incorporated with a single director and shareholder, who can be the same person and located anywhere in the world. This versatility, combined with the Seychelles’ stable political and economic environment, makes it a cornerstone of many international business strategies and a popular vehicle for offshore company formation.

3D workflow diagram of Seychelles IBC incorporation steps including name check, document preparation, digital filing, and certificate issuance
Visual guide to the Seychelles IBC incorporation process

The Step-by-Step Process for IBC Company Incorporation Seychelles

We’ve distilled the incorporation journey into a clear, four-step process, managing every detail on your behalf with precision and expertise.

Step 1: Company Name Approval and Verification

First, you provide us with your desired company name. We conduct a thorough check with the Seychelles Financial Services Authority (FSA) to ensure it’s unique and complies with naming regulations (e.g., must end in a suffix like ‘Ltd,’ ‘Inc,’ or ‘Corporation’). This initial step is typically cleared within a few hours.

Step 2: Preparation of Incorporation Documents

Our legal team then drafts the essential corporate documents: the Memorandum of Association and the Articles of Association. Concurrently, we collect the necessary due diligence (KYC) documents from you, which typically include a certified copy of your passport and a recent proof of address. Accuracy here is key, and we guide you through every item.

Step 3: Filing with the Seychelles Registrar

Once the documents are prepared and signed, we submit the entire application package through the official government portal. In a recent filing for a client’s consulting firm, we uploaded the complete package at 10 AM Seychelles time, and the Certificate of Incorporation was issued by the registrar just before 3 PM the following business day. This is a testament to the registry’s efficiency and our team’s meticulous preparation.

Step 4: Delivery of Your Corporate Documents

Upon successful incorporation, we receive the official Certificate of Incorporation, Memorandum & Articles, and other essential corporate documents. We immediately provide you with high-resolution digital copies. If required, we can also assist in obtaining apostilled copies for international use, such as opening corporate bank accounts.

Requirements for IBC Registration in Seychelles

To ensure a smooth registration, here’s a clear checklist of the mandatory requirements:

  • Company Name: Must be unique and end with an appropriate suffix (Ltd, Inc, Corp, etc.).
  • Directors: A minimum of one director is required. They can be of any nationality and reside anywhere. Corporate directors are also permitted.
  • Shareholders: A minimum of one shareholder is needed. Like directors, they can be an individual or a corporate body from any country.
  • Registered Agent & Office: Every IBC must have a licensed Registered Agent and a physical Registered Office in the Seychelles. We provide this service as a core part of our incorporation package, ensuring your company remains in good standing.
  • Due Diligence Documents: We are legally required to verify the identity and address of all directors, shareholders, and beneficial owners. This typically involves:
    • A clear, certified copy of a valid passport.
    • A recent utility bill or bank statement (dated within the last 3 months) as proof of residential address.

Taxation Policies for IBCs in Seychelles

The tax framework is one of the most compelling reasons to choose the Seychelles. The system is based on a territorial principle, meaning a company is only taxed on income generated within the Seychelles.

For a typical Seychelles IBC whose business activities (clients, services, and operations) are exclusively outside the country, the tax liability within the Seychelles is zero. This includes:

  • 0% Corporate Income Tax on worldwide profits.
  • 0% Capital Gains Tax.
  • 0% Withholding Tax on dividends, interest, or royalties paid to non-residents.
  • 0% Stamp Duty on the transfer of shares or assets.

This straightforward and advantageous tax regime is enshrined in law, as outlined by the International Business Companies (Amendment) Act, 2018, which ensures Seychelles remains compliant with international standards while supporting global business.

Ongoing Compliance Requirements for Seychelles IBCs

Maintaining your Seychelles IBC is simple and cost-effective. The key ongoing obligations are:

  1. Annual Renewal Fee: This single government fee keeps your company in good standing. For a standard IBC, the government license fee we process for our clients is a fixed $150 USD, which we handle to ensure it’s paid on time, every time.
  2. Registered Agent and Office: You must maintain your Registered Agent and Office in the Seychelles. Our annual service fee covers this, along with basic compliance reminders.
  3. Accounting Records: All IBCs are required to maintain reliable accounting records that correctly explain their transactions. These records can be kept anywhere in the world, but a copy must be accessible through your Registered Agent in the Seychelles. There is typically no requirement to file annual accounts with the authorities.

Seychelles IBC vs. BVI IBC: A Quick Comparison

FeatureSeychelles IBCBVI Business Company
Incorporation SpeedExtremely fast (24-48 hours)Very fast (1-3 days)
Annual Govt. FeeGenerally lowerHigher, based on share capital
ConfidentialityHigh (No public director/shareholder register)High (No public director register, but names can be obtained via court order)
Accounting RecordsMust be kept, but no audit/filing requiredMust be kept, annual financial return required (no audit)
Global ReputationExcellent, white-listed by OECDPremier, globally recognized standard
Best ForCost-effective, fast, and private global operationsBlue-chip standard, widely accepted by all global banks

Common Pitfalls and How to Avoid Them

  • Failing to Keep Proper Records: Mistake: Thinking “no taxes” means no bookkeeping. Solution: Maintain clear, organized accounting records from day one. This is a legal requirement and crucial for managing your business effectively.
  • Ignoring Annual Renewal Deadlines: Mistake: Forgetting to pay the annual government license fee. Solution: This leads to penalties and the company being struck off the register. Our team at We Form Online manages these deadlines for you, ensuring uninterrupted good standing.
  • Using a Non-Responsive Registered Agent: Mistake: Choosing an agent based solely on the lowest price. Solution: A slow or inexperienced agent can jeopardize your company’s compliance. Partner with a proven, professional agent who provides timely support and expert guidance.
  • Misunderstanding “Tax-Free”: Mistake: Assuming a Seychelles IBC eliminates all taxes everywhere. Solution: While your IBC pays no tax in the Seychelles on foreign income, you may still have personal or corporate tax obligations in your country of residence or operation. Always seek professional tax advice.

Glossary of Key Terms

  • International Business Company (IBC): A private corporation designed for offshore, international business activities.
  • Registered Agent: A licensed firm in the Seychelles appointed to manage all official corporate correspondence and ensure compliance with local laws.
  • Registered Office: The physical address of your company in the Seychelles, provided by the Registered Agent.
  • Memorandum and Articles of Association: The company’s constitution, outlining its purpose, share structure, and internal governance rules.
  • Apostille: A form of international certification that authenticates a document for use in another country, governed by the Hague Convention.
  • Beneficial Owner: The true individual who ultimately owns or controls the company, even if shares are held by a nominee or another corporation.

Frequently Asked Questions (FAQ)

1. Can I open a bank account for my Seychelles IBC?

Yes, you can open a corporate bank account worldwide. Banks will require a full set of certified and often apostilled company documents, which we can help you prepare. We can offer our banking services with https://www.wfopay.com/ and other operators.

2. Do I need to visit the Seychelles to incorporate my company?

No, the entire process is handled remotely. We manage all communication and filings with the Seychelles authorities on your behalf. One day after submiting the form, you will have a company.

3. What is the minimum capital required?

There is no minimum paid-up capital requirement. A standard IBC is typically registered with an authorized share capital of USD 5,000 or USD 50,000, but these shares do not need to be paid for upon incorporation.

4. Is a Seychelles IBC considered “blacklisted”?

No. The Seychelles is a compliant and reputable jurisdiction. It is white-listed by the OECD and has implemented regulations to meet international standards on transparency and tax information exchange.

5. Can a Seychelles IBC hold real estate?

Yes, an IBC can own property in the Seychelles or in other countries, subject to local laws in the jurisdiction where the property is located.

6. What happens if I don’t pay the annual renewal fee?

If the annual fee is not paid on time, the company will incur penalties. If it remains unpaid, the Registrar will eventually strike the company from the register, causing it to cease to exist legally.

7. Who is a Seychelles IBC right for?

A Seychelles IBC is ideal for international consultants, digital nomads, e-commerce businesses, holding companies for global investments, and entrepreneurs seeking a simple, low-cost, and private corporate structure.

While Seychelles is an excellent option for many, we support entrepreneurs in a wide range of locations. You can explore all jurisdictions we serve to find the perfect fit for your business needs.

Launch Your Global Business with We Form Online

A Seychelles IBC provides a powerful combination of speed, confidentiality, and tax efficiency, making it one of the world’s leading choices for international entrepreneurs. But a successful offshore strategy depends on expert execution and management. At We Form Online, we don’t just form companies; we build the foundations for your global success.

Our experienced team handles every legal requirement, compliance deadline, and administrative detail, so you can operate with confidence and clarity.

Ready to launch your business? Start your Seychelles company formation with We Form Online today. Our team is ready to provide a personalized consultation and get your incorporation started immediately.

About the Author

This guide was written by Sabrina Andrade, a corporate service provider with over 10 years of specialization in offshore corporate structures and international business law. As a key member of the We Form Online legal team, along with Iliya Talman, he has personally overseen the incorporation of hundreds of Seychelles IBCs and provides expert guidance on compliance and governance.

This article provides general information and does not constitute legal or tax advice. We recommend consulting with our specialists to discuss your specific circumstances.

Schedule a 15 minutes introduction call with our experts to meet your exact business needs

Schedule a Free Consultation Today